Governed or characterized by caprice; apt to change suddenly; freakish; whimsical; changeable. |  | source: webster1913
adjective satellite
| 2 |
changeable |  | Example: a capricious summer breeze freakish weather
source: wordnet30
| 3 |
determined by chance or impulse or whim rather than by necessity or reason |  | Example: a capricious refusal authoritarian rulers are frequently capricious the victim of whimsical persecutions
source: wordnet30
